There is a need to empirically validate theoretical Machine Learning research. This can be di cult because the algorithms being tested often require large amounts of training data. Softbots provide a unique solution to this problem. Softbots or software robots are intelligent agents that interact with software environments. By attaching the agent directly to the training environment, it is possible for softbots to gather their own training data. St. Bernard is a softbot that locates les within the UNIX 1 le system. It is based on the theory of satis cing search. The training data used by satis cing search is gathered directly from its environment.
